The Northern California Chapter AVS Undergraduate Scholarship offers $5,000 to full-time first- and second-year undergraduates majoring in specific science and engineering fields at universities in northern California or Nevada. Applicants must have a GPA of 3.0 or higher.

Applications must include a 1-page statement of purpose. The deadline to apply is April 17, 2026.
